UNIVERSAL Technologies is seeking a Lead Full-Stack .NET Developer to support the enhancement and development of enterprise systems that manage the lifecycle of critical infrastructure assets across New York City. This multi-year position requires onsite availability 3/days per week in New York City, NY. This role requires a strong background in application and database development using .NET technologies, as well as experience working on large-scale, multi-team IT initiatives. WHO WE ARE: UNIVERSAL Technologies, LLC is a Women-Owned (M/WBE) IT solutions and consulting company focused on delivering enterprise systems that significantly improve our clients' IT performance. We work across the IT spectrum including Development, Business/Systems/Data Analysis, Project Management, Cyber Security, Network Engineering, and High-Level System Architecture. Our team members thrive in a culture of transparency, innovation, and growth. We aim to place talented professionals in roles that support impactful and mission-driven technology projects. WHAT WE OFFER: Our W2 employees can expect the following benefits: • Competitive pay • Health/Dental Insurance • Group Life Insurance • 401K • HSA/FSA • Pre-Tax Transportation Program • Generous Paid Time Off/Holiday Policy MANDATORY SKILLS/EXPERIENCE: Candidates who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ered. • Minimum of 5 years’ experience overseeing medium to large-scale projects with multiple work streams and distinct deliverables • Proven ability to coordinate and delegate assignments for project teams of 15+ consultants • Experience serving as the primary point of contact for project status, meetings, reporting, scope changes, and technical issues • At least 8-years of Expertise in application design, database design, coding, and integration/performance testing • Strong hands-on experience with .NET 3.5/4.0/4.5, .NET Core, ASP.NET, C#, MVC, Razor, and related technologies • Experience with T-SQL, stored procedures, SSIS, and SQL Server 2014/2017 • Development of secure web applications with role-based access control • Experience with Microsoft Visual Studio 2017/2019 and SQL Server Management Studio • Familiarity with front-end technologies such as H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, AJAX • Use of SSRS for reporting and data migration/transformation • Experience with tools such as Azure DevOps, Microsoft Test Manager, Team Foundation Server • Knowledge of SDLC methodologies including Waterfall, RUP, Agile/SCRUM • Strong communication, leadership, problem-solving, and documentation skills • Ability to estimate and deliver development tasks on schedule • BA/BS degree in a technology-related field • Microsoft certifications preferred • 3 years of mentoring junior developers • 6+ years of object-oriented development experience • 2 years of enterprise/solution/application architecture experience • 4+ years developing applications using C#, ASP.NET, MVC, ADO.NET, Entity Framework, LINQ, Bootstrap, AngularJS, BackboneJS, AJAX, WCF, and WPF • Experience in designing solutions using SOA and asynchronous messaging (MSMQ/WebSphere MQ) • Integration with RESTful or SOAP-based APIs • 4+ years of database experience including SQL Server 2019/2022, SSIS, ERwin/ERStudio • Strong experience with configuration management and CI/CD using Azure DevOps or TFS • Exposure to GIS tools, mobile/disconnected applications, and map integration • Experience in designing large-scale workflow management systems • Knowledge of Business Intelligence and Decision Support Systems • Prior experience on federal/state/local government or asset management system development projects • Familiarity with UML/Rational or other design tools •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ite SCOPE OF SERVICES: The Senior Developer will work closely with NYC-based business units, IT development teams, and other stakeholders to design and deliver new enterprise systems and improve existing applications. Responsibilities include: • Detailed design and hands-on coding of web applications • Database architecture, normalization, and query optimization • Developing modules with secure, scalable .NET architecture • Creating and integrating web-based user interfaces using modern front-end frameworks • Implementing and consuming web services (WCF, REST, SOAP) • Managing source control, builds, and deployments • Creating technical documentation including use case diagrams, architecture documents, and design specifications • Supporting system testing, defect resolution, and ongoing maintenance • Leading and mentoring junior developers • Contributing to technical design discussions and architecture decisions • Ensuring adherence to SDLC processes and best practices UNIVERSAL Technologies is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
